Canada: Wholesale sales rose 0.7% to $63.6 billion in November
"Wholesale sales rose 0.7% to $63.6 billion in November, a second consecutive increase," Statistics Canada announced on Monday.
Key highlights
Sales were up in six of seven subsectors, representing 99% of wholesale sales.
The food, beverage and tobacco subsector and the motor vehicle and parts subsector led the gains.
In volume terms, wholesale sales increased 0.5%.
Wholesale inventories were down 1.2% to $81.1 billion in November, the first decline in eight months.
Three of the seven subsectors were down, representing 60% of total wholesale inventories.
